How Do Veterinarians Initially Assess Lameness in Animals?

Veterinarians start with a general inspection, observing the animal’s posture, gait, and weight distribution. They look for visible signs of injury, swelling, or abnormalities in the limbs. The animal’s movement is evaluated to identify any limping, stiffness, or reluctance to bear weight on a particular leg. This initial assessment helps narrow down the potential area of concern for further examination.

How Does Palpation Aid in Locating the Source of Lameness?

Palpation involves carefully feeling the animal’s limbs to identify areas of pain, swelling, or unusual tissue consistency. By applying pressure with their fingers, veterinarians can detect subtle abnormalities that may not be visible. This technique helps pinpoint the exact location of the injury or inflammation causing the lameness, guiding further diagnostic tests and treatment.

How can I tell if my dog is faking a limp?

It’s difficult to know if a dog is faking a limp, but look for inconsistencies in their gait. If the limp disappears when distracted or excited, it might not be genuine. However, always consult a vet to rule out underlying medical issues.

What are the first signs of lameness in animals?

The first signs of lameness include limping, stiffness, reluctance to bear weight, and changes in posture. The animal may also exhibit pain when the affected limb is touched or moved. Early detection and veterinary care are essential to prevent the condition from worsening.

Can lameness indicate a more serious underlying condition?

Yes, lameness can be a symptom of various underlying conditions, such as arthritis, infections, tumors, or systemic diseases. A thorough veterinary examination is necessary to determine the root cause and provide appropriate treatment. Ignoring lameness can lead to chronic pain and reduced quality of life for the animal.
